
Virat Kohli Reaction After Sam Konstas Wicket: Indian bowlers looked to be in excellent form during Australia’s first innings in the Sydney Test. During this innings, Mohammad Siraj showed the way to the pavilion to Australia’s young opener Sam Constance. On the first day of the match, the atmosphere between Constance and Jasprit Bumrah was seen heating up. Now, what Virat Kohli did after Constance was out was worth seeing.
Siraj sent Constus to the pavilion in the 12th over of the innings. The Australian opener scored 23 runs in 38 balls with the help of 3 fours. After Constance’s wicket fell, Kohli asked the crowd to cheer. This reaction of Kohli is becoming increasingly viral on social media.

Debate between Constas and Bumrah
On the first day of the match, a heated argument was seen between Jasprit Bumrah and Sam Constance. Bumrah and Constance clashed during the last over of the day. After this clash, Bumrah showed the way to the pavilion to Australia’s second opener Usman Khawaja. Since then, the dominance of Indian bowlers is being seen.
Siraj took 2 wickets in one over
Apart from Constance, Siraj also sent Australia’s star batsman Travis Head to the pavilion in the 12th over of the innings. Head could score only 04 runs in 3 balls with the help of 1 four. Head’s wicket was very important for India because he has scored two centuries in the series.
Team India was dealt cheaply in the first innings
Let us tell you that in the Sydney Test, Team India won the toss and decided to bat. Batting first, Team India was limited to 185 runs. During this, Rishabh Pant played the biggest innings for the team and scored 40 runs with the help of 3 fours and 1 six. Apart from this, almost all the other batsmen of the team looked flop.
